

WWE Hall of Famer Edge is loving his return to WWE. The Rated R Superstar returned to WWE in 2020, but won the Royal Rumble the following year to headline WrestleMania 37. Edge was forced to retire back in 2011 due to what was thought to be a career-ending injury. WWE fans were extremely despondent at seeing one of their favorite superstars retire at an early age.
However, Edge stayed sharp and worked his way out of the injury to come back and main event WrestleMania. In a recent interview, Edge reveals that whether he ever believed that he would main event WrestleMania.

Edge reveals he believed in himself to main event WrestleMania
Edge, who recently main evented Wrestlemania 37, lost the match to Roman Reigns in a match which also featured Daniel Bryan. The former WWE Champion has main evented Wrestlemania in his first spell at WWE. In a recent interview with Kurt Angle on The Kurt Angle Show, Edge discussed his WWE career and more.
At one point, the host Kurt Angle revealed an image of Edge at WrestleMania 6 watching as a fan. Kurt followed up by asking whether he ever thought he would one day main event, the biggest pay-per-view of WWE.

Edge replied he believed in himself to be in the main event of WrestleMania one day. He also added how important it is to clear away the barriers that stop someone away from their dream.
Edge added- “You know in my mind, yeah. I think I had to have that belief. You know, honestly, everyone who is getting into this sh*t should have this belief. You also need some self-awareness and understand that there might be some things put in your path that might make it impossible. So I had that self belief to not accept the answers that I was getting.”
The Rated R superstar is still a vital force for WWE
There are instances where a WWE Hall of Famer would make his return for a match and two and be sidelined after that. However, this is not the case with Edge. The former World Champion has still got it and has proved that he belongs in the ring rather than sitting at home.
Edge, since his return, has faced superstars such as Randy Orton, Roman Reigns, Daniel Bryan, and Seth Rollins. His recent match against Seth Rollins at SummerSlam had it all. The bout featured some great promos and impressive moves in the ring.

Since his return, Edge has been part of the blue brand of WWE. But as per recent reports, The Rated R Superstar is set to switch from SmackDown to WWE Raw. The addition of Brock Lesnar and Becky Lynch to SmackDown has seriously made the brand more dominant. Therefore, rumors suggest Edge will switch to RAW to aid the brand in a well-needed boost in viewership.
